Baker Hughes, announced Tuesday its largest order ever of Integrated Compressor Line, ICL, units with Dubai Petroleum Establishment, DPE, for and on behalf of Dubai Supply Authority, DUSUP, to enhance the reliability of energy supply and support local decarbonization efforts. The order was booked in the third quarter of 2024. The 10 ICL units – five for gas storage and five for dual-use injection boosting or gas export to the existing gas distribution system – will be installed at the Margham Gas storage facility in Dubai, significantly increasing its capacity. Through the adoption of the ICL technology, the project aims to achieve a high-reliability system with reduced emissions. The project will provide stability to Dubai’s energy supply by strengthening the system’s ability to switch between natural gas and solar power.
